Magellan Aerospace Corporation announced an agreement with an undisclosed customer for the supply of complex machined rotating engine components for military aircraft platforms. The contract will be carried out at Magellan's facility in Mississauga, Ontario over a five year period commencing in 2020.
The contract is valued at approximately $46.4 million.
